1 E.,,,,,,,. 1.., ;Jr, ~Ir y lli.—The New Yuri:
Ecral.Fa special 11.1 viers f...:ra heat-
quartersof the Brit eh army in Abyssinia
1 stop that King Theodore is at his camp
near the palace ol Magvhda, where the
English captives ore confined. The
Abyssinian Monarch is said to be to a
bad strait in a military point of vies , .
An engagement between the two armies
la Imminent, and may take place at any
moment.
Very few of that: disaffected native
chiefs now acknoWlalge any foal& to
Theodore. The chef Kass!, rater of the
Tigre Districtopenly courts the favor of
Motor General Napier. General . Napier
fears that this chief, whose • political
character is had, ainia eta secret attack on
him, and consequently seek. to arrange
and perfect a binding treaty of alliance
with him so as to hold him answerable
for his future arts. i . .
Thirty-five thousand Eritish; of all
classes, have been landed at Zehla, and
the advance of tluf Queens army has
reached to within two days' march of
Auntie, half-Way towards Magdala, from
the shore line, where it Is very probable
the expected battle Will take place. The
Egyptians, with a cOntingentambracing
many Mirka, are very near to Magdata,
bct they use no cannon, and still march
on La el reckless manner without the
sanction of the superior officers of thf
English army. The Engliah in theln
tetior number about twenty thousand,
The troops , suffered considerably
the heat of the weather.
Dispatches from Senate announce that
the Britieh expeditionary oorpn had oe
ir
copied Addegraft, am reports reached
Senate that the ads. nee had reached
Beret and Taints. t was also an
nounced from the lota for that the na
tives" who had revolted against Sing
Theodore were again submitting to his
authority. ..

great nucabens in Navarre. Skirmishes have taken pbtee between the civil guard
tithe itaturgents In the city of Navarre,
the Queen's °dicers maintaining their al
legiance. S o ma row persons were
wounded during the tumult, and the an
cient Inmeh-flumano, province of Na
varro is agitated at many points.. It NI.
pears as Ii the movement is the, result of
a deliberate and well plannedorganiza
tion. Thy pollee are on the alert, and
have u.ired documentary evidence of the
tact. The officals have already found
and carried away from Navarro three
thousand copies of revolutionary pla
cards. or m inifestnes, addressed to the
people of Spain. Each copy Is headed
with n wood cut or porarall, an it is teem
ed, of the eider son of Don Juan, who is
entitled and named Charles the VII. of
Spain. Tho young gentleman is second
Connie to Queen Isabella and grandson
of Don Carlo, who made warn rains& her
ascension to the throne ; Don Juan, his
father, Is the sou of Don Claim,
